生命周期法:DSS开发详解与案例研究

需积分: 12 7 下载量 43 浏览量 更新于2024-08-21 收藏 457KB PPT 举报
生命周期法是一种广泛应用于决策支持系统(DSS)开发中的系统化方法论,它关注从系统的需求分析、初步设计、详细设计直至最终程序编制的完整过程。DSS是计算机辅助决策工具,旨在帮助组织和个人在复杂信息环境中做出更好的决策。DSS主要分为三个技术层次:专用DSS、DSS生成器和DSS工具。 1. **DSS的三个技术层次**: - **专用DSS**:这是一种专门为特定用户设计,具备决策支持功能的计算机信息系统,如美国加州警察巡逻任务部署系统,它直接服务于用户决策。 - **DSS生成器**:是一种软件和硬件系统,如Execucom公司的IFPS和Boeing计算机服务公司的EIS,它们简化了定制DSS的过程,可以快速构建财务计划决策支持系统。 - **DSS工具**:这些是基础技术和单元,包括程序库如净现值计算程序、图像处理工具、规划软件包、数据库查询软件以及风险分析工具,它们构成DSS生成器和专用DSS的基础。 2. **DSS系统开发方法**: - **生命周期法**:采用阶段化的方式,包括系统分析(理解用户需求)、初步设计(确定系统框架)、详细设计(编写具体程序)和程序编制,最后整合各部分形成完整的DSS系统。 - **快速开发法**:强调快速迭代和适应性,适用于需求变化频繁的环境。 - **最终用户开发法**:非专业人员参与开发,优点是减少泄密和误解,但可能导致质量参差不齐和共享困难。 - **适应性设计方法**:注重在整个过程中根据用户反馈进行调整,强调用户、开发者和DSS之间的持续沟通。 - **完全DSS开发法**:可能是生命周期法的另一种表述,涵盖系统的全面开发流程。 3. **具体实例与应用**: - 使用生命周期法开发DSS时,会先通过需求分析确定目标,然后细化为系统分析、初步设计阶段,进一步细化到详细设计阶段,每个阶段都会编写相应的程序,并在完成后集成所有组件以形成完整的DSS系统。 通过这些方法,DSS系统不仅能够提高决策效率,还能随着业务发展进行灵活调整。生命周期法以其结构化和渐进的方式,确保了决策支持系统的质量和实用性,适合各种规模和复杂度的企业环境。